TERMS LIST
Troll - Someone who causes trouble for their own amusement
Considered Troll - When something is considered troll, that means that it is assumed that the post was made to cause trouble
Flamebait - A post that has high potential to start heated arguments.
Avatar - A small picture under your username
Signature (sig) - a short text message or image that follows all of your posts.
Private Message (PM) - A message sent to another user that is not shown to other users.
Spam - a post that has no purpose other than to take up space or advertise something
Shock Site - A website with graphic content intended to disgust and/or shock the viewer. These sites often contain graphic images of sexually deviant behavior and/or death. Linking to a shock site WILL get you banned.
